<center lang="jzgs1et"></center><address dropzone="c9j2u5w"></address><time dir="tb041yd"></time>

当 TP 钱包无法进入“薄饼”——链上交互故障的全景技术指南

最新版 TP 钱包进不了薄饼的现象,表面是“打不开 dApp”或“交易失败”,本质牵涉到多层链上/链下协同与系统治理。本指南从根因到对策,以工程化视角拆解并指引修复。

一、典型流程(逐步检查点)

用户在 dApp 浏览器中发起 Swap → 前端构造交易数据(ABI 与参数)→ 发起签名请求(EIP-712 或原生签名)https://www.china-gjjc.com ,→ 钱包返回签名并推送到 RPC 节点 → RPC 广播到 BSC 节点 → 验证/打包 → PancakeSwap 智能合约执行 → 事件回调并更新前端。任一环节异常都会导致“进不去”或交易失败。

二、常见故障与定位策略

- dApp 与钱包兼容性:检查 WebView 是否禁用 window.ethereum、是否被 CSP 或跨域策略拦截。建议用内置调试日志或外部浏览器对比。

- RPC 与网络配置:确认链 ID、RPC endpoint、速率限制、节点同步状态;尝试切换公共/私人节点以排除节点拥塞或被墙问题。

- 签名协议不一致:EIP-712、personal_sign 行为差异会导致签名校验失败,检查前端签名串与智能合约验证逻辑。

- 授权/Allowance 问题:Token Approve 未生效或滑点设置过低,交易会 reverted。

- 版本与权限审计:新版客户端可能改变了权限管理或沙箱策略,需阅读更新日志并回溯权限模型。

三、链下计算与安全支付平台建议

将复杂定价、路径计算、前端模拟等放到链下计算服务,可减少 on-chain 失败窗口;引入可信执行环境或门限签名为支付中继提供防篡改能力。采用支付中台做非托管的中继(meta-transaction)可以缓解用户链上 gas 管理,前提是严格的审计与风控。

四、系统审计与数据化转型路径

构建自动化审计流水:从前端 RPC 请求、签名记录、交易广播到链上回执形成闭环日志;结合行为分析和告警规则,实现故障自动定位与业务 KPI 驱动的改进。

结语:排查 TP 钱包进入薄饼的故障,既是单次故障修复,也是推进钱包与 dApp 走向链下/链上协同、安全支付平台和数据化运维的契机。依靠分层定位、增强审计与链下能力,可把偶发故障转化为可控、可升级的产品能力。

作者:柳岸技术兄发布时间:2025-08-26 04:38:45

评论

TechLiu

非常实用的排查流程,尤其是关于签名协议差异的提示,帮我定位了问题。

区块链菜鸟

读完才知道原来 RPC 节点也会让 dApp 无法打开,谢谢详尽的说明。

NodeWatcher

建议再补充一些具体的日志关键字和命令行排查示例,会更工程化。

安全审计师

关于链下计算与TEE的建议很到位,能有效降低攻击面同时提升用户体验。

小明Dev

把 meta-transaction 与风控结合讲得很好,实践中很有参考价值。

相关阅读